Have your say on Lambeth’s Citizens’ Assembly on the Climate Crisis
Lambeth Council is hosting its first Citizens’ Assembly on the Climate Crisis from 25th May – 3rd July. The assembly is made up of 50 randomly selected Lambeth residents, representative of the borough on a range of demographic characteristics.
